The goal of screening for cervical cancer is to detect precancerous changes in cervical cells that can be treated to prevent the illness from spreading. Cancer is occasionally diagnosed during cervical checkups. Cervical cancer in its early stages is usually easier to treat. Cervical cancer may have already spread by the time symptoms appear, making treatment more difficult. Cervical cancer screening can be done in three ways: The HPV test looks for high-risk HPV strains that might cause cervical cancer in cells. The Pap test, also known as a Pap smear or cervical cytology, collects cervical cells to be evaluated for HPV-related abnormalities that, if left untreated, can lead to cervical cancer. Cervical cancer and precancerous cells can both be detected.
